About Khursheed Ahmad
Khursheed Ahmad is a scholar working on Electrochemistry, Bioengineering, Polymers and Plastics,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ment and Electrical and Electronic Engineering, having authored 192 papers that have together received 3.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Conducting polymers and applications (47 papers), Electrochemical sensors and biosensors (45 papers), Perovskite Materials and Applications (34 papers), Electrochemical Analysis and Applications (32 papers), Gas Sensing Nanomaterials and Sensors (31 papers), Analytical Chemistry and Sensors (29 papers), Advanced Photocatalysis Techniques (25 papers) and Supercapacitor Materials and Fabrication (21 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Electrochemistry (583 citations), Polymers and Plastics (921 citations), Bioengineering (329 citations),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(809 citations) and Electrical and Electronic Engineering (2.3k citations). Khursheed Ahmad has collaborated with scholars based in South Korea, India and Saudi Arabia. Frequent co-authors include Shaikh M. Mobin, Haekyoung Kim, Akbar Mohammad, Waseem Raza, Rais Ahmad Khan, Praveen Kumar, Mohd Quasim Khan, A.M.A. Henaish, Mahesh A. Shinde and Shagufi Naz Ansari. Their work appears in journals such as Biosensors, Materials Chemistry and Physics, Diamond and Related Materials, International Journal of Hydrogen Energy and Optical Materials.
